Soil stabilization is a technique for improving the quality of soil for road construction. Soil-stabilized roads require less maintenance and don't have problems like potholes, rutting, and mudding.  Here are some soil stabilization techniques: Lime: Lime can be added to low-quality soils to create a usable base and sub-base.
